[Tim]
>> Well, then since that isn't ISO 8601 format, it would be nice to have
>> a comment explaining why it's claiming to be anyway <0.5 wink>.

[Fred]
> Hmm, that's right (ISO 8601:2000, section 5.4.2).  Sigh.

Ain't your fault.  I didn't remember that I had seen the XML-RPC spec
before, in conjunction with its crazy rules for representing floats. 
It's a very vague doc indeed.

Anyway, some quick googling strongly suggests that many XML-RPC
implementors don't know anything about 8601 either, and accept/produce
only the non-8601 format inferred from the single example in "the
spec".  Heh -- kids <wink>.
